Seat-map renderer builds for the Orpheline Theatre project started failing on Tuesday after the layout fixture update. The snapshot tests disagree on row curvature by one pixel on the CI runners only; local runs pass. Suspect font rasterization differences on the new runner image. Pinning the runner image resolves it for now. The failing job is reproducible under the token below.

session token of kageg-tahop = htk14_af3c1ccccb7dcf

**Handover note — Grindleton inventory reconciliation**

Handing the nightly reconciliation job over ahead of the audit. It compares warehouse counts from the Tarnwick ledger against the Pellhurst storefront and writes discrepancies to a review queue. Nothing exotic, but note it runs with elevated database grants, which is why it's in scope for your review. Cron fires at 02:10 local. The job reads its settings from a mounted file at startup; the current contents are reproduced below.

service settings:
PRAIX_LOG_LEVEL=error
PRAIX_METRICS_HOST=metrics.praix.qorvelcorp.corp
PRAIX_POOL_SIZE=16

## Service Accounts — Glimmerboard Admin

Dark mode landed last sprint, but the theme-preference sync still runs under the `glimmer-svc` account rather than per-user creds. Not ideal, we know — tracked in the backlog. For now, reviewers testing the toggle against staging should authenticate the sync worker with the shared internal key, which you'll find directly below this line.

gateway credential: kto23_LX9A4ys6i4nzHtpOLNLodKK

/*
 * Cold-start behavior of the Hollis handlers, for discussion at eng sync:
 * first invocations pay for runtime init plus the Verdane config fetch,
 * so we keep a small warm pool and pre-resolve secrets at deploy time.
 * Raising the pool cuts p99 latency but costs idle capacity.
 * The current tuning constants follow.
 */

limits module of fajog-tawig:
RATE_LIMITS = {
    "druwyn": 2,
    "quenael": 10,
    "wenix": 2,
    "druael": 2,
}